Hop on board for an in-depth look into the Chippewa Valley’s rich history of athletic achievement, storied competition, and surprising connection to national-level sports including the Packers, the Brewers, the Olympics and so much more. We’ll visit the Carson Park Hall of Fame to hear the truly incredible history of Eau Claire baseball including legends like Hank Aaron, Bob Uecker, Joe Torre and others. We’ll visit the base of Mt. Washington, taking in the incredible Flying Eagles Ski Jump Facility, to hear this community’s celebrated history of soaring through the air on skis. But there’s so much beyond baseball and skis — hear historic and current stories of high-level achievement in football, basketball, Indy and NASCAR racing, hockey, volleyball, running, water skiing and more. Plus unexpected and off-beat sports from horseshoes and kubb to curling and log-rolling. There’s even an Eau Claire sports connection to the long running tv show The Simpsons!
